Transaction 704ec075da4f055d3c6310ee75e036aecd85cb79b89b0513fd3cdfc31b677a2a

1 Input
2 Outputs
  • 704ec075da4f055d3c6310ee75e036aecd85cb79b89b0513fd3cdfc31b677a2a:0
  • value  3414830
    address  3KAe14XmMA3QVoCGU1BPUbN7pKp69YqYjt
  • 704ec075da4f055d3c6310ee75e036aecd85cb79b89b0513fd3cdfc31b677a2a:1
  • value  8229367
    address  15HT4sDFkkkvTG9PKr18NKPLNCyYAEhhQb